Transaction 1262140114b3d6a9c0bf69585071670f133e99be8767a0720739507e39d59021
1 Input
1 Output
-
1262140114b3d6a9c0bf69585071670f133e99be8767a0720739507e39d59021:0
- value
- 859053
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 efa3ea2db679b0f1a95e4bf328bd21d173f31a2b OP_EQUAL
- address
- 3PY7nPUsgkjdxPy32Po7vbhZTkDisU2zcP